Solve the following measurements:


  1. On a certain map, the straight-line distance between Pas ans Winnipeg is 4.1cm. If the scale of the map is 1cm=120cm, how far apart are the Pas and Winnipeg, to the nearest kilometer?
  2. On a scale drawing of a house, the scale is 1cm:4cm. If the actual house is 30cm, what is the length of the line in the drawing that represents the width of the house?
